#2e511c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e511c is composed of 18% red, 31.8%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.4%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 99.6 degrees, a saturation of 48.6% and a lightness of 21.4%. #2e511c color hex could be obtained by blending #5ca238 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#2e511c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2e511c has RGB values of R:46, G:81,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 3035420.

Shades and Tints of #2e511c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050803 is the darkest color, while #fafd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2e511c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#363835 is the less saturated color, while #266a03 is the most saturated one.
